We used black dresses for our bridesmaids. They were from Davids Bridal and under 100 bucks (on sale on the website). I loved them!
If you're not set on the idea of the dresses matching, I would imagine you can find dresses pretty much anywhere fitting your description. Especially right now, with all the holiday dresses out in department stores.
My bridesmaids wore black, both from David's Bridal, and under 200.00. They have tons of simple dresses there, and most are under 200.00.
I'm doing black too and I had the hardest time finally deciding. We decided on Eden Bridal #7266 in Black and I love them, they are simple, but they are exactly what I was looking for!
i'm also doing black BM dresses... i don't want them to match so i think i may look at Nordstroms with all the girls and see what they like. I agree, with the holidays there are usually great deals on LBD's... especially New Years party dresses.
I am doing black cocktail length bridesmaid dresses as well. My little secret, well not so secret, is Nordstroms. We found namebrand, stylish but simple, cocktail dresses in black that are perfect!! They were under $200 and Nordstroms will also taylor for free on any dress purchase. I am so happy I didn't go with an overpriced bridal store when I could get namebrand dresses from Nordstroms for a better price. The girls are also excited to be able to add a little black cocktail dress to their wardrobe for future parties.
I'm doing the black BM dress thing too. My maids chose Bill Levkoff Style 378. We had three fairly different body types and it looked great on all of them. I think the price was $220 maybe but they get 20% off where I purchased my dress. I found it for about $150-180 online.

I REALLY love the idea of black bridesmaids dresses. It makes me think classy and elegant. I am leaning towards cocktail length, and i'm looking for something simple, but not too plain. Turns out this is much easier said than done! I can't seem to find what i'm looking for anywhere. Anyone have any ideas where to find cute black bridesmaid dresses? Any suggestions will be much appreciated!
Side note...I really want to stay under $200...this also adds another obstacle!
